ABC company creates specialty shipping bags that they sell to pharmaceutical companies across the globe. With their current equipment, ABC can produce 12,000 shipping bags for every 10 bundles of materials purchased. Every month (20 working days), ABC purchases 100 bundles of materials. Each bundle requires one (1) labor minute to process, and every labor hour costs an average of $14.00. Each week (5 working days), ABC pays $5,000 in overhead costs, and equipment costs $600 a day to operate.
How many shipping bags does ABC produce in a standard month (20 working days)? Each workday (8 hours)?
What is the single-factor productivity for labor, per workday (8 hours)? What is the multi-factor productivity, for every dollar spent per shipping bag?
